Counted locally with the o200k_base tokenizer, which is exact for GPT models; Claude uses its own tokenizer and its counts differ. Treat this as one consistent yardstick across the catalogue rather than a bill. Prices are per million input tokens.

GraphQL Budget Discipline (read first)
GitHub meters two separate hourly budgets: ~5,000 GraphQL points/hr and ~5,000 REST requests/hr. Tools that drive a GitHub Project board (e.g. Detent) already spend the GraphQL budget on ProjectV2 polling (Projects v2 is GraphQL-only). If this skill also leans on GraphQL for routine PR ops, the two collide and exhaust the shared pool — a CI-watch loop alone can burn hundreds of GraphQL points per PR. Keep routine PR work on the REST budget through the shared helper:
- CI status / watch: use
github_watch_pr_checksorgithub_check_snapshot, always pinned to the expected PR head SHA. - PR metadata: use
github_current_prandgithub_pr. - Formal reviews: use
github_pr_reviews. - Mergeability: read REST
.mergeableand.mergeable_statethroughgithub_pr. - Ordinary merge: use the REST pull merge endpoint with
merge_methodand the expected head SHA.
The only GraphQL exceptions in these workflows are review-thread discovery and
resolution, closingIssuesReferences, and required merge-queue enqueueing.
The sibling e2e-verify, address-review, and complete-issue skills source
the same shared helper and follow this discipline.
